软考
APP下载

遗留系统的评价框架

随着信息技术的不断升级换代,许多企业的传统系统逐渐成为了遗留系统。这些系统通常存在着一些问题,例如性能低下、功能不完备、安全威胁等,给企业的运营和管理带来了很多难题。为了对遗留系统进行有效的评价和改进,本文将从多个角度分析遗留系统的评价框架。

第一、技术角度

在技术角度上,可以从以下多个方面评价遗留系统:

1. 代码质量:包括程序结构、可读性、重用性等方面。通过评估遗留系统的代码质量,可以确定应该采取哪些技术手段来改进代码。

2. 性能指标:包括系统响应时间、占用资源、可伸缩性等方面。通过对系统性能进行测量并评估,可以确定系统哪些方面需要改进。

3. 处理能力:包括并发处理、容错能力、可靠性等方面。通过评估处理能力,可以确定系统应该如何进行改进,以提高其可靠性和稳定性。

第二、业务角度

在业务角度上,可以从以下多个方面评价遗留系统:

1. 功能完备性:包括系统的功能是否完备,能否满足企业的业务需求等方面。通过评估系统的完备性,可以确定系统需要哪些功能改进、升级等方面的改进。

2. 可维护性指标:包括代码可读性、易维护性、易扩展性等方面。通过对系统的可维护性进行评估,可以确定改进哪些方面,让系统更加易于维护。

3. 用户体验:包括系统的易用性、易学习性、易操作性等方面。通过评估用户体验,可以确定系统应该如何改进以提高用户的使用体验,降低用户的使用成本。

第三、安全角度

在安全角度上,可以从以下多个方面评价遗留系统:

1. 数据安全:包括数据完整性、数据保密性、数据可用性等方面。通过评估数据安全,可以确定哪些方面需要加强保护,以确保数据安全。

2. 安全性指标:包括系统是否存在漏洞、是否存在安全威胁等。通过评估安全性指标,可以确定系统安全风险并提供相关的改进方案。

3. 访问控制:包括用户权限管理、访问控制等方面。通过评估访问控制,可以确定哪些方面需要改进,以提高系统的安全性。

综上所述,遗留系统的评价需要从多个角度进行分析。从技术、业务和安全角度评估遗留系统可以公正、全面地评价企业的旧系统,从而为改进提供重要的指导。

备考资料 免费领取:系统架构设计师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统架构设计师题库